How they compare
Afghanistan currently reports 2.64 billion against 2.39 billion in Brunei, a difference of 248.74 million.
That makes Afghanistan's figure about 1.1 times Brunei's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2017 it was Brunei ahead.
Afghanistan ranks 89th and Brunei ranks 90th of 150 countries.
Brunei has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
